If 90% of Management Training is a Waste of Money, Choose the Worthwhile 10%2010-03-16
March 16, 2010 - Press Dispensary - Management training may be highly popular but 90% is a waste of money, according to a study conducted by Detterman and Sternberg. Surprising though it may seem, popular management training provider, Orgtopia (http://www.orgtopia.co.uk ), is happy to tell its clients this damning figure. Orgtopia believes its fresh and bespoke approach puts it within the successful 10% that makes corporate time and investment in management training worthwhile.
David Hinde, managing director of Orgtopia, says the biggest problem comes from standard training courses that don’t address the issues faced by employees at work. He explains: "To gain a return on investment, attendees must be able to take the ideas from the course and apply them successfully to their environment. We have clients ranging from the army, digital strategy agencies, broadcast companies, software developers and manufacturers. The way in which these organisations use management theories can be worlds apart. So public courses that teach 'one size fits all' theories are an ineffective way of changing workplace performance and should be avoided in favour of tailored methods that address specific issues." Mr Hinde continues: "Orgtopia’s approach is different to standard public courses without necessarily being more expensive. We get to know an organisation and focus on understanding its environment, key issues, clients and current management approaches. We then apply a set of pre-built training modules to design a course specifically for the individual client. This approach includes writing lifelike scenarios and exercises so attendees can practise the ideas in realistic situations. We’ve found time and time again that attendees can successfully apply the ideas from the training when they return to work."
